According to 6Wresearch internal database and industry insights, the Global Explosive Ordnance Disposal Machines Market was valued at USD 0.67 Billion in 2024 and is expected to reach USD 1 Billion by 2031, growing at a compound annual growth rate of 6.41% during the forecast period (2025-2031).
The Global Explosive Ordnance Disposal Machines Market is experiencing steady growth driven by increasing security concerns and the rise in terrorist activities worldwide. These machines are utilized by military and law enforcement agencies for safe disposal of explosive devices. Key market players are focusing on developing advanced technologies to enhance the efficiency and safety of these machines. The market is also witnessing a trend towards the integration of robotics and artificial intelligence in explosive ordnance disposal machines to improve precision and reduce human involvement in high-risk scenarios. North America currently dominates the market due to high defense spending, while Asia Pacific is expected to exhibit significant growth opportunities attributed to increasing defense budgets and rising terrorist threats in the region.

The Global Explosive Ordnance Disposal Machines Market faces several challenges, including high initial investment costs for purchasing and maintaining advanced EOD machines, limited availability of skilled personnel trained in operating these specialized equipment, and the constant need for upgrading technology to keep up with evolving threats. Additionally, regulations and restrictions on the export and import of EOD machines across different regions pose hurdles for market expansion. Moreover, the complexity of handling various types of explosive devices and materials requires continuous research and development efforts to enhance the efficiency and effectiveness of EOD machines. Overall, navigating these challenges requires strategic planning, innovation, and collaboration among industry players and government agencies to ensure the safety and security of personnel involved in explosive ordnance disposal operations.

Government policies related to the Global Explosive Ordnance Disposal Machines Market primarily focus on regulation, standardization, and safety measures. Many countries have stringent regulations in place to control the export and import of explosive ordnance disposal machines to prevent misuse and ensure national security. Additionally, governments often set standards for the design, production, and operation of these machines to guarantee their effectiveness and reliability in hazardous environments. Safety measures, such as training requirements for operators and maintenance protocols, are also emphasized to minimize risks and protect personnel. Overall, government policies play a crucial role in shaping the Global Explosive Ordnance Disposal Machines Market by promoting responsible usage and fostering innovation in technology.

In the Global Explosive Ordnance Disposal Machines Market, Asia is expected to witness significant growth due to ongoing military modernization programs in countries like China and India. North America is projected to dominate the market, driven by increased defense expenditure and technological advancements. Europe is anticipated to see steady growth, with countries like the UK and France investing in advanced EOD machines. The Middle East and Africa region is likely to experience moderate growth, attributed to the rising security concerns and conflicts in the region. Latin America is expected to show promising growth opportunities, fueled by the increasing focus on counter-terrorism efforts and border security measures in countries like Brazil and Mexico.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
